                  RE: thumb issues

                  I can't say for sure what the issue is with your thumb, but I would suggest that you get a second medical opinion from an experienced driller. I would have span and pitches checked out. Also if your driller just drilled your thumb hole with a drill bit and just sanded it a little with the little round disc that could be a major problem. No one has a thumb shaped like a drill bit. The thumb hole must be custom adjusted after drilling the hole with the bit. My guy actually takes a micrometer and measures the thumb from a few perspectives and then adjusts the hole to those measurements. And let me tell you it fits like it was made just for my thumb. The drill bit is perfectly round and symmetrical, but no one's thumb is that way. I cringe when I see people drill a thumb hole and just sand it a little and bevel the edge of the hole!

                  There are also molds that can be made of your thumb and from these custom thumb inserts can be made. Always remember this: anyone can drill a hole in a ball, but when you pay a driller you are paying them for their knowledge and expertise not their labor!
